Output 84b3a359dd55ff03988bd41be484076ce1cf24c52120e42fdf621ae4585d0d16: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 175817932a7843c67869bf93c625661ea80f4291 OP_EQUALVERIFY OP_CHECKSIG
address
138S5A9jmQgki6e5mjTVLS4nMRxp5phyic
transaction
84b3a359dd55ff03988bd41be484076ce1cf24c52120e42fdf621ae4585d0d16
spent
true